So... I'm thinking about how to have puppet manage different operating systems. It's one thing to use a selector to determine the value of specific resources attribute, but what do you do when a file may not exist on a specific O/S? You can't use a selector in this case.
I really don't like the approach described here either... http://m0dlx.com/blog/Puppet_manifests__a_multi_OS_style_guide.html ...where classes are loaded dynamically based on the value of a variable. What would best practice indicate? Doug. -- You received this message because you are subscribed to the Google Groups "Puppet Users" group.
